List of ambassadors of Kiribati to China
Ambassador of Kiribati to China | |
---|---|
Inaugural holder | Atanraoi Baiteke |
Formation | November 13, 1982 |
The Kiribati ambassador in Beijing is the official representative of the Government in Tarawa to the Government of China.
